ToggleWhy a Winter Home Remodel Plan Beats a Spring Scramble
Most people wait until the first warm weekend to think about remodeling. By then?
- Contractors are booked.
- Material prices are higher.
- Permit offices are slammed.
- Your project gets pushed… and pushed… and pushed again.
Planning a winter home remodel fixes that. Here’s why it’s smarter:
1. You see your home at its “worst”
Winter shows every flaw:
- Cold spots that scream “insulation problem”
- Dark areas begging for better lighting or Living Space Renovation
- Muddy entryways that need smarter storage or Exterior Renovations
That makes your priorities super clear when you start talking about a Full Home Renovation or smaller focused projects.
2. You get better scheduling and less stress
Spring and summer are peak build months. When you plan in winter, you can:
- Lock in stronger dates with your contractor
- Use smart home renovation scheduling tips to phase work around holidays, school breaks, and travel
- Push all the messy work into a time that works for you, not just for the contractor
Your future self will be very grateful you didn’t start this the week before a graduation party.
3. You can grab off-season remodeling deals
Winter is prime time to ask about:
- Off-season remodeling deals on labor for interior projects
- Vendor promos on cabinets, flooring, or bath fixtures
- Bundled pricing when you combine Kitchen Remodeling, Bathroom Remodeling, and Basement Renovations
You’re not cutting corners you’re just not paying “everyone wants this right now” pricing.

Winter Home Remodel Checklist (Northern Virginia Edition)
Use this quick list to get ready and feel free to copy it into your notes app:
Big picture
- Decide which rooms matter most (kitchen, baths, basement, exterior, etc.)
- Set a realistic budget range + 10–15% contingency
- Decide: plan this winter, build this spring/summer
Research & hiring
- Shortlist licensed, insured contractors in Northern Virginia
- Read reviews on Google, Houzz, and social media
- Schedule consultations with AZA Builders and 1–2 others if you like to compare
Design & planning
- Collect inspiration photos for each room
- Make a “must-have” and “nice-to-have” list
- Discuss off-season remodeling deals and timing with your contractor
- Lock in a design agreement and get on the schedule
Pre-construction
- Confirm permits are submitted
- Finalize selections (cabinets, counters, tile, flooring, fixtures)
- Plan where you’ll cook/clean/sleep during work (especially for kitchen or bath projects)
Check off these items, and you’ll be miles ahead of most homeowners before spring even starts.
